The Australian zebra finch or chestnut-eared finch (Taeniopygia castanotis)is the most common estrildid finch of Central Australia and ranges over most of the continent, avoiding only the cool humid south and some areas of the tropical far north. The bird has been introduced to Puerto Rico and Portugal.
